Comprehending the German Shepherd Breed
German Shepherds are medium to large-sized pet dogs, normally weighing in between 50 to 90 pounds. Pros of Owning a German Shepherd
- Intelligence: German Shepherds are among the most intelligent dog types, making them quick learners and excellent working dogs.
- Adaptability: They can master numerous roles, consisting of service pet dogs, therapy canines, and search-and-rescue pet dogs.
- Commitment: They form strong bonds with their owners and are understood for their loyalty and protective nature.
- Trainability: With consistent training and socializing, German Shepherds can learn numerous commands and tricks.
Cons of Owning a German Shepherd
- Workout Needs: They require regular exercise to remain healthy and pleased; neglecting exercise can result in behavioral issues.
- Grooming: Their double coat needs routine brushing to manage shedding.
- Protective Nature: While this quality can be beneficial, it might likewise cause aggressive habits if not properly trained and interacted socially.
Finding Reputable Breeders in Austria
When looking for a German Shepherd puppy, it is vital to find a credible breeder who prioritizes the health and character of their canines. Below are steps to assist you recognize reliable breeders:
- Research Online: Start by searching for breeder directories, type clubs, and online forums dedicated to German Shepherd enthusiasts in Austria.
- Check out Kennels: Schedule check outs to prospective breeders' kennels to observe their conditions and satisfy the puppies' moms and dads.

- Inspect References: Ask for referrals from previous purchasers to gather insights into their experiences.
- Trust Your Instincts: Pay attention to how breeders engage with their pets. Credible breeders will treat their dogs with care and respect.
Costs Associated with Buying a German Shepherd Puppy
The rate of a German Shepherd puppy in Austria can vary significantly based upon aspects like pedigree, breeder track record, and location. On average, purchasers can expect to pay in between EUR800 to EUR2,500 for a puppy. Here's a breakdown of possible expenses:
- Initial Purchase Price: EUR800 - EUR2,500
- Preliminary Vaccination and Microchipping: EUR100 - EUR300
- Basic Training Classes: EUR150 - EUR300
- Grooming Supplies: EUR50 - EUR150
- Food and Nutrition: EUR50 - EUR150 each month
- Veterinary Care: EUR300 - EUR500 annually
While the upfront costs may seem overwhelming, it is important to consider the long-lasting dedication and responsibilities related to dog ownership.
Getting ready for Your New Puppy
Bringing a German Shepherd puppy into your home requires preparation. Here's a list to ensure you are prepared:
- Create a Safe Space: Set up a designated area for your puppy with a comfy bed, toys, and food/water bowls.
- Puppy Proof Your Home: Remove hazards such as electrical cables, poisonous plants, and little things that could be swallowed.
- Stock Up on Supplies: Purchase food, bowls, collars, leashes, and grooming tools.
- Plan for Training: Consider enrolling the puppy in a training class or working with an expert trainer.
FAQs About Buying German Shepherd Puppies in Austria
What are the common health problems in German Shepherds?
German Shepherds can be susceptible to several health issues, including:
- Hip and elbow dysplasia
- Degenerative myelopathy
- Allergies
- Bloat (stomach torsion)
How can I find a German Shepherd rescue in Austria?
Several organizations focus on saving and rehoming German Shepherds. Online platforms such as Petfinder or local animal shelters often have details on readily available dogs. Furthermore, breed-specific rescue groups are exceptional resources.
Is it important to mingle my German Shepherd puppy?
Definitely! Early socializing is crucial for establishing a well-rounded dog. Exposing your puppy to numerous environments, people, and other animals helps in reducing anxiety and guarantees they mature to be confident and well-adjusted.
Can German Shepherds live in apartment or condos?
While German Shepherds can adjust to apartment living, it is necessary to ensure they get sufficient exercise. Daily strolls and playtime are essential to their health and happiness.
